What is Sculptra?

Sculptra is an FDA-approved injectable made from poly-L-lactic acid (PLLA). Unlike traditional fillers that add instant volume, Sculptra works by stimulating your skin to produce its own collagen over time. This gives you gradual, natural-looking results that can last up to two years or more.

  • Restores lost facial volume without looking overdone or artificial
  • Stimulates collagen production for long-term skin improvement
  • Results last significantly longer than most standard dermal fillers

Cost of Sculptra in Korea

Sculptra is typically priced per vial, and most patients need two to three vials per session depending on the treatment area and degree of volume loss.   • Single vial (entry-level clinic): ₩400,000 – ₩600,000 (approximately $300 – $450 USD)
  • Single vial (mid-range clinic): ₩700,000 – ₩1,000,000 (approximately $520 – $750 USD)
  • Single vial (premium clinic): ₩1,100,000 – ₩1,500,000 (approximately $820 – $1,120 USD)
  • Full face package (2–3 sessions): ₩3,000,000 – ₩6,000,000 (approximately $2,200 – $4,500 USD)

For comparison, a single vial of Sculptra in the United States can cost $900 to $1,500 USD or more. Korea offers strong savings, especially when combining multiple vials or sessions. What to Expect During and After

A Sculptra session in Korea typically takes between 30 and 60 minutes. Your doctor will apply a topical numbing cream before the injections. The product is delivered through a fine needle or cannula into the deeper layers of the skin. Most patients feel only mild discomfort during the procedure.

After treatment, you may notice some swelling, redness, or bruising at the injection sites. These effects are temporary and usually resolve within three to five days. Your doctor will ask you to massage the treated area regularly during the first week to help distribute the product evenly and prevent small lumps from forming. Follow-up and Results

Sculptra does not show instant results. Collagen production builds gradually over eight to twelve weeks after each session. Most patients need two to three sessions spaced four to six weeks apart for best results. Once complete, results can last up to two years. Many patients choose to return for a maintenance vial once a year to preserve their results. Korean clinics often offer follow-up check-ins to monitor your progress and adjust the plan if needed.
